Manipuri romantic fiction has evolved from classical epic cycles and traditional folklore into a modern genre that balances with social realism . While earlier works focused on idealized love and the "spirit of romanticism," contemporary collections often interweave romance with themes of social upheaval , identity, and cultural tradition. Modern tech shapes modern love. Many contemporary stories explore how romance blossoms over Facebook Messenger, WhatsApp, or Instagram. Long-distance relationships—often driven by Manipuri youth moving to metros like Delhi, Bangalore, or Guwahati for education and employment—form a massive sub-genre within these collections. 3. Vibrant, nostalgic, and sweet, campus romances are immensely popular. These stories capture the essence of youth in Manipur, featuring local hangouts, festival celebrations (like Yaoshang), and the innocent thrill of first love amidst exams and college friendships. To understand these stories, we must first understand the phrase "Eina." This seemingly simple word is a cornerstone of the Meitei language and culture. Most directly, as the search for “how to say i love you in manipuri” will reveal, “Eina nungshi” is the heartfelt phrase for “I love you.” This linguistic fact immediately connects “Eina” to the core of romance. However, the word’s use goes far beyond a single phrase. It is a powerful lyrical pronoun, meaning "I" or "me," and it frequently appears as the first word of a personal confession, as seen in the popular love poem that begins, "Eina nangbu nungsi" ("I love you" in Meitei).
